2. What is Collagen and Its Role in Skin Health?
Collagen is the most abundant protein in our body, constituting about 30% of total protein content. It is a fundamental building block of various tissues, including skin, bones, tendons, and ligaments. In the skin, collagen provides structure and strength, enabling it to withstand the effects of aging and environmental stressors. As we age, collagen production decreases, leading to sagging skin, wrinkles, and reduced elasticity.
3. Types of Collagen: Why Fish Collagen Stands Out
There are at least 16 types of collagen, but the most relevant for skin health are types I, II, and III. Fish collagen, predominantly type I, is known for its superior bioavailability compared to other sources, such as bovine or porcine collagen. This means that our bodies can absorb and utilize fish collagen more effectively, making it a preferred choice for those looking to boost skin elasticity.

5. How to Incorporate Fish Collagen Peptides into Your Routine
Integrating fish collagen peptides into your daily routine is simple and can yield remarkable results for your skin.
5.1 Recommended Dosage
The ideal dosage of fish collagen peptides may vary based on individual needs and product formulations. However, studies suggest that a daily intake of 5 to 10 grams is effective in promoting skin health. It's best to start with a lower dose and gradually increase it to assess how your body responds.
5.2 Best Forms of Fish Collagen
Fish collagen peptides come in various forms, including powders, capsules, and drinks. Powders are particularly versatile, allowing you to mix them into smoothies, coffee, or even baked goods. Capsules are convenient for those who prefer a quick supplement option, while ready-to-drink collagen beverages offer a tasty way to enjoy the benefits on the go.
6. Choosing Quality Fish Collagen Peptides
When selecting fish collagen peptides, it's crucial to choose high-quality products to ensure maximum efficacy. Look for supplements that are sourced from wild-caught fish, as these are typically free from harmful chemicals and pollutants. Additionally, opt for hydrolyzed collagen, as this form is more easily absorbed by the body. Check for third-party testing and certifications to guarantee product purity and potency.
7. Possible Side Effects and Considerations
While fish collagen peptides are generally safe for most individuals, some may experience mild side effects, such as digestive discomfort or allergic reactions. If you have a fish allergy or sensitivity, it's essential to consult with a healthcare professional before adding fish collagen to your regimen. Pregnant or nursing women should also seek medical advice prior to use.
8. FAQs About Fish Collagen Peptides
1. What is the difference between fish collagen and other collagen types?
Fish collagen is primarily type I collagen, known for its high bioavailability and effectiveness in promoting skin health, while other types, such as bovine or porcine collagen, may contain different types of collagen that are more suited for joint or bone health.
2. How long does it take to see results from fish collagen peptides?
Results can vary, but most individuals begin to notice improvements in skin elasticity and hydration within 4 to 8 weeks of consistent use.
3. Can I take fish collagen if I’m vegetarian or vegan?
No, fish collagen is derived from fish sources and is not suitable for vegetarians or vegans. Plant-based alternatives, such as collagen-boosting supplements, are available for those adhering to a plant-based diet.
4. Is fish collagen safe to consume daily?
Yes, fish collagen is safe for daily consumption when taken in recommended doses. However, it’s always best to consult with a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ement.
5. Are there any foods that can enhance collagen production?
Yes, foods rich in vitamin C (such as citrus fruits), antioxidants (like berries), and amino acids (found in meat, dairy, and legumes) can help enhance the body's natural collagen production.
